Output 59a7f5dcd689ffa068340dc3bab748ec07c9fe2bbe081ffec67f2f5450deaefb:6

value
45684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9284fb133f517c35d71739450b246ab1366f17c OP_EQUAL
address
3L2e2yn55VaqdCiiVh8FSMu67wwwW5PwAD
transaction
59a7f5dcd689ffa068340dc3bab748ec07c9fe2bbe081ffec67f2f5450deaefb
spent
true